Summer is a wonderful season filled with sunshine, vacations, outdoor activities, and longer days. However, the rising temperatures also increase the risk of dehydration. Our bodies lose more water through sweating as we try to stay cool. If we do not replace this lost fluid, we may experience fatigue, headaches, dizziness, poor concentration, and even heat-related illnesses. Staying hydrated is not just about drinking water whenever you feel thirsty. It involves maintaining a healthy balance of fluids and electrolytes throughout the day. Proper hydration supports body temperature regulation, digestion, circulation, joint lubrication, and overall physical and mental performance. Whether you are working outdoors, exercising, traveling, or simply relaxing at home, following good hydration habits can help you stay healthy throughout the summer.
